Architecture

A Financial Operating System Redesign, within cryptocurrency, options, and derivatives, necessitates a fundamental re-evaluation of existing technological infrastructure to accommodate the demands of decentralized finance. This redesign prioritizes modularity and interoperability, enabling seamless integration with diverse blockchain networks and trading venues. Scalability becomes paramount, requiring solutions like layer-2 protocols and optimized consensus mechanisms to handle increasing transaction volumes and complex derivative structures. The resulting architecture must support real-time risk management, automated settlement, and transparent audit trails, crucial for institutional adoption and regulatory compliance.
